Roberts joined Scottish Premiership side Celtic on a season-long loan deal from Premier League outfit Manchester City in the summer transfer window.
The 20-year-old winger had returned to his parent club City earlier in the summer following an 18-month loan spell at Celtic Park.
Roberts is good friends with Celtic defender Tierney, and the former Fulham youngster has praised the left-back.
The England Under-20 international winger has also stated that the 20-year-old Scotland international left-back loves playing for Celtic.

“KT has been a big help to me since I came to Celtic,” Roberts told The Scottish Sun about Tierney. “It’s great to play football with one of your best mates.
“For his age, he has incredible experience and maturity. KT’s potential is incredible. He has a big future and will go to the top.
“Big clubs will look at him but he’s a Celtic lad, he loves playing for the club. I think he has Celtic duvets! But seriously, he’s living the dream. He’s a top talent and a top lad.”

Roberts’s comments about Tierney should allay the Celtic fans’ worries over the future of the star defender.
Tierney is one of the best, most promising and most talented young left-backs in the world. The youngster was linked with a number of clubs in England in the summer transfer window.
While The Sun credited Manchester United and Arsenal with interest in the youngster back in June, The Mirror linked Liverpool with the defender.
Top clubs from England will come calling next summer, but Celtic fans can be optimistic that Tierney is not going to force a move out of Celtic Park.
